WORSHIP
- The feeling or expression of reverence and adoration for a deity
- to honor and love as a divine being [v WORSHIPED, WORSHIPING, WORSHIPPED, WORSHIPPING, WORSHIPS]
- The acts or rites that make up a formal expression of reverence for a deity; a religious ceremony or ceremonies
- Adoration or devotion comparable to religious homage, shown toward a person or principle
- to honour as a divine being [v WORSHIPED or WORSHIPPED, WORSHIPPING, WORSHIPS]
- Honor given to someone in recognition of their merit
- Used in addressing or referring to an important or high-ranking person, esp. a magistrate or mayor
